Mountain America Foundation

Mountain America Foundation, of Sandy, UT, is a Private Foundation tracked in Imperigo's IRS 990 database. The 2025 filing shows $387K in revenue, $1.5M in expenses, $2.0M in total assets. IRS filings disclose 583 grants awarded by this foundation, totaling roughly $5.2M.

Financial Trends

Year Revenue Expenses Assets
2025 $387K $1.5M $2.0M
2024 $244K $1.2M $3.2M
2023 $690K $1.9M $4.1M
2022 $6.0M $714K $5.3M

Between 2022 and 2025, reported annual revenue declined from $6.0M to $387K (-94%), with total assets most recently reported at $2.0M.
